The Role of Industrial Waste Water Therapy in Environmental Management



The efficient therapy of industrial wastewater is increasingly acknowledged as a cornerstone of ecological defense, serving to minimize the harmful influences of contaminants on aquatic ecosystems. As markets evolve and broaden, the need for durable wastewater administration services ends up being critical to ensure compliance with ecological regulations and advertise lasting methods.


Importance of Waste Water Therapy





The relevance of wastewater treatment can not be overemphasized, as it plays a critical role in securing public health and wellness and the environment (Industrial Waste Water Treatment). Effective wastewater treatment systems are necessary for getting rid of contaminants from industrial discharge, thereby protecting against hazardous compounds from going into all-natural water bodies. This procedure minimizes the danger of waterborne illness, which can emerge from untreated wastewater, and safeguards community health


Furthermore, dealt with wastewater can be securely recycled in different applications, such as watering and commercial procedures, advertising lasting water monitoring techniques. By reusing water, sectors can significantly reduce their freshwater usage, contributing to source conservation.




Along with wellness advantages, wastewater treatment is essential for preserving aquatic ecosystems. Contaminants in unattended wastewater can lead to the degradation of water high quality, damaging water life and interrupting eco-friendly equilibriums. By treating wastewater before discharge, sectors help preserve the stability of regional ecological communities and advertise biodiversity.


Furthermore, regulative conformity is a vital facet of wastewater monitoring. Sticking to recognized ecological criteria not only prevents legal effects but also boosts a firm's credibility as a responsible business citizen. In essence, reliable wastewater treatment is vital for securing public health and wellness, securing the atmosphere, and promoting sustainable industrial techniques.

Resources of Industrial Waste Water



Industrial wastewater originates from a range of resources, each adding to the complexity of treatment procedures. Mainly, these resources include producing centers, refineries, and handling plants, which create effluents as a by-product of their operations. Industries such as textiles, pharmaceuticals, food and drink, and petrochemicals generate substantial volumes of wastewater, typically packed with pollutants consisting of hefty steels, natural substances, and nutrients.


Along with manufacturing, agricultural activities contribute to industrial wastewater with drainage and effluent from livestock operations and plant processing. The meat and dairy markets, particularly, are recognized for launching high degrees of biochemical oxygen need (FIGURE) and virus.


Moreover, mining and mineral processing tasks produce wastewater including suspended solids and dangerous chemicals. Power generation plants, particularly those using nonrenewable fuel sources, likewise contribute wastewater through cooling systems and chemical cleaning processes.


Each of these sources provides distinct challenges concerning the composition and volume of wastewater produced, requiring tailored therapy remedies to mitigate their ecological effect. Recognizing the diverse beginnings of industrial wastewater is essential for establishing efficient monitoring strategies targeted at shielding water resources and advertising lasting commercial techniques.


Therapy Procedures and Technologies



Efficient treatment procedures and innovations are important for handling industrial wastewater and mitigating its ecological effect. Various approaches are utilized to remove impurities, adjust to different wastewater features, and follow regulatory criteria.


Physical therapy processes, such as sedimentation and purification, assist in the elimination of put on hold solids. These methods are often made use of as preliminary steps to minimize the load on succeeding treatment phases. Chemical treatment, including coagulation, neutralization, and flocculation, addresses liquified pollutants by changing their chemical homes, making them easier to separate from water.


Organic therapy technologies, such as activated sludge systems and biofilters, utilize bacteria to degrade organic issue and nutrients. These approaches are especially reliable for biodegradable waste streams, promoting the all-natural disintegration process. Advanced treatment innovations, such as membrane layer filtration and advanced oxidation processes, deal boosted elimination efficiencies for difficult contaminants, consisting of hefty steels and persistent organic compounds.


Each of these treatment procedures can be set up in numerous mixes to develop tailored solutions that satisfy certain commercial demands. The selection of modern technology depends on factors such as the kind of wastewater, desired treatment results, and economic considerations, making sure that sectors can run sustainably while minimizing their ecological footprint.

Regulative Structure and Compliance



A thorough regulatory framework controls the treatment of industrial wastewater, making certain that industries stick to rigorous compliance requirements. Numerous national and regional laws, such as the Clean Water Act in the United States, established forth restricts on the discharge of pollutants into water bodies. These guidelines are made to safeguard water ecological communities and public health by mandating that markets carry out appropriate treatment innovations.


Conformity with these laws often includes acquiring authorizations, performing regular monitoring, and reporting discharge levels to regulative authorities. Failing to abide can cause substantial penalties, including fines and operational restrictions, Your Domain Name thus incentivizing markets to embrace finest methods in wastewater administration.


In enhancement to governmental laws, several industries additionally stick to voluntary requirements and certifications, such as ISO 14001, which advertise lasting ecological management techniques. Stakeholders are increasingly advocating for boosted openness and responsibility in wastewater management, pushing for more stringent enforcement and more rigorous coverage needs.


Eventually, a robust governing structure not only offers to minimize environmental risks yet additionally promotes a culture of sustainability within the commercial industry, encouraging continual enhancement in wastewater treatment procedures.
